A grinding device for stainless steel goods processing
Technical Field
The utility model relates to a polishing technical field, in particular to a polishing device for stainless steel goods processing.
Background
In the production process of the stainless steel product, a polishing device is used for surface treatment to obtain a smooth stainless steel finished product, and the polishing device is widely applied; the existing polishing device has certain defects when in use, a stainless steel product cannot move in the horizontal direction so that the polishing length cannot be adjusted, meanwhile, the angle of the stainless steel product cannot be adjusted, inconvenience is brought to polishing operation of three hundred sixty degrees, certain influence is brought to the use of the polishing device, and therefore the polishing device for processing the stainless steel product is provided.

In the figure: 1. a frame body; 2. a base; 3. a first motor; 4. a guide sleeve; 5. a rotating shaft; 6. a grinding wheel; 7. a sleeve; 8. a load-carrying seat; 9. a second motor; 10. a baffle plate; 11. a screw; 12. an inner threaded sleeve; 13. a load-bearing column; 14. a sponge sleeve; 15. stainless steel pipe fittings; 16. a cavity is communicated; 17. an inner barrel; 18. a clamping groove; 19. a limiting sleeve.
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
As shown in fig. 1-3, a polishing device for processing stainless steel products comprises a frame body 1 for providing a polishing mechanism mounting support, the frame body 1 is of a concave structure, a base 2 is welded on the lower surface of the frame body 1, the frame body 1 and the base 2 form a main body of the polishing device for providing the polishing mechanism mounting support, a first motor 3 is fixedly mounted at the middle position of the top of one side outer wall of the frame body 1, guide sleeves 4 are welded at the top positions of two sides of the inner wall of the frame body 1 and at the position of one side inner wall close to the first motor 3, a rotating shaft 5 is vertically and movably connected at the middle position of one side wall of the first motor 3, a grinding wheel 6 is fixedly sleeved at the middle position of the outer surface of the rotating shaft 5, the first motor 3 operates to drive the rotating shaft 5 positioned by the guide sleeves 4 to rotate, so as to realize high-speed rotation of the grinding wheel, a sleeve 7 is welded on a side wall of the frame body 1 close to the first motor 3, a load-carrying seat 8 is vertically welded on a bottom of a side wall of the frame body 1 far away from the first motor 3, the load-carrying seat 8 is used as a support body to realize the installation of the driving structure, a second motor 9 and a baffle 10 are fixedly installed on the upper surface of the load-carrying seat 8, the baffle 10 limits one side of the horizontal adjusting structure, a screw rod 11 is vertically and movably installed on the second motor 9 through the middle position of a side wall of the baffle 10, one end of the screw rod 11 far away from the second motor 9 is vertically and movably connected with the frame body 1 through a corresponding guide sleeve 4, the screw rod 11 is arranged below the rotating shaft 5, an inner threaded sleeve 12 is slidably sleeved on the outer surface of the screw rod 11, a load-bearing column 13 is welded on the front wall of the inner threaded sleeve 12, a sponge sleeve 14 is fixedly sleeved on the outer surface of the load, the second motor 9 operates to drive the screw rod 11 to rotate, the screw rod 11 serves as a transmission part and is matched with the inner screw sleeve 12 during rotation to realize the movement of the bearing column 13 installed by the inner screw sleeve 12 in the horizontal direction, the flexible fixation between one side of the stainless steel pipe 15 and the bearing column 13 is realized through the sponge sleeve 14, so that the polishing length of a stainless steel product can be adjusted, the inner surface of the sleeve 7 is welded with the inner cylinder 17, the middle position of the inner wall of the inner cylinder 17 is provided with the clamping groove 18, the outer surface of the stainless steel pipe 15 is movably sleeved with the limiting sleeve 19 matched with the clamping groove 18, the sleeve 7 provides the installation guide for the screw rod 11, the inner cylinder 17 is matched with the limiting sleeve 19 through the clamping groove 18 to form a positioning body which acts on the other side of the stainless steel pipe 15 far away from the support body, when the stainless steel pipe 15 moves, force is applied to the limiting sleeve 19, at the moment, thereby realizing the angle adjustment of the stainless steel product so as to facilitate the grinding operation of three hundred sixty degrees.
The two groups of guide sleeves 4 positioned on the same side are vertically distributed in parallel, and the rotating shaft 5 is vertically and movably connected with the frame body 1 through the guide sleeves 4 positioned on the two sides;
the sleeve 7 is arranged in front of the bottom guide sleeve 4, and the sleeve 7 is arranged below the first motor 3;
the baffle 10 is arranged in the middle of the second motor 9 and the frame body 1, the lower surface of the baffle 10 is vertical to the top of the load-bearing seat 8, and the input ends of the first motor 3 and the second motor 9 are electrically connected with the output end of an external power supply;
the bearing column 13 is transversely installed, the stainless steel pipe 15 is movably sleeved on the outer surface of the bearing column 13 through the sponge sleeve 14, the stainless steel pipe 15 is arranged in front of the screw rod 11 in parallel, the upper surface of the stainless steel pipe 15 is contacted with the lower surface of the grinding wheel 6, a through cavity 16 is formed in a position, close to one side wall of the second motor 9, of the frame body 1, and the screw rod 11 and the stainless steel pipe 15 are both arranged inside the through cavity 16;
one end of the stainless steel pipe 15 far away from the second motor 9 is connected with one side wall of the frame body 1 through the sleeve 7 in a penetrating way, and the limiting sleeve 19 is movably connected with the inner cylinder 17 through the clamping groove 18.
